The game between the Columbus Blue Jackets and Montreal Canadiens will take place at Nationwide Arena in Columbus, Ohio on Wednesday, November 23 at 7:00 PM ET.
The Montreal Canadiens will travel to the Nationwide Arena to take on the Columbus Blue Jackets in the NHL on Wednesday. Columbus defeated the Florida Panthers 5-3 in their last game. Goals from Johnny Gaudreau, Yegor Chinakhov, Boone Jenner, Kent Johnson and Sean Kuraly ensured that the Blue Jackets registered their seventh win of the season.
Columbus coach Brad Larsen said after the game, “You need someone to hold fort for you. You look at all the good teams, their goalies do that for them. And Tarasov did it pretty much all night tonight.”
Montreal on the other hand were thrashed 7-2 by the Buffalo Sabres in their last game. Cole Caufield and Sean Monahan scored the goals for the Canadiens as they lost their ninth game of the season. Goaltender Jake Allen saved 31 of the 38 shots aimed at him and finished the game with a save percentage of .816.
Canadiens coach Martin St. Louis spoke after the game and said, “I think the first two power plays had some good chances. The last four weren’t very strong. We want to create scoring chances and I think apart from tonight, our power play in the last 10 games was still pretty good. It’s just that tonight wasn’t our night.”
